How you'll bring the magic to the floor as our Food & Beverage Assistant

  • Has a positive, can‑do attitude towards customers and other team.
  • A genuine enthusiasm for learning about all things food and drink — including spirits, wines, cocktails, and delivering the “perfect serve”.
  • A willingness to understand different food styles and service standards, learn the menus, and confidently explain dishes to customers.
  • Strong communication skills and enjoyment of interacting with guests in a lively, fast‑paced environment.
  • The ability to deliver great service — taking orders, serving food and drink, processing payments, and ensuring every guest has an excellent experience.
  • Commitment to meeting site service standards and working effectively as part of the team.
  • A developing or good understanding of preparing coffees and serving alcohol and wine in both bar and restaurant settings.
  • Availability to work opening and closing shifts, including weekends and bank holidays on a pro‑rata basis.
  • A willingness to continue your development through in‑house and external training sessions.
